Alex Bridges is a Wealth Advisor and the founder of Tiverton Wealth. He established the firm after serving as Chief Strategy Officer for a Houston-based investment management firm, bringing with him a foundation in comprehensive financial planning and a client-centered approach. Alex began his career in January 2017 with Northwestern Mutual, where he developed core planning and advisory skills that continue to inform his work today. Alex holds the C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ER® (CFP®), Chartered Financial Consultant® (ChFC®), and Retirement Income Certified Professional® (RICP®) designations. These credentials reflect his commitment to professional standards, continuing education, and thoughtful financial planning across areas such as wealth accumulation, retirement income planning, risk management, estate planning, and tax efficiency. In his role as an investment adviser representative of a registered investment adviser, Alex acts as a fiduciary to clients. Alex founded Tiverton Wealth to provide advice that is aligned with clients’ best interests and structured on a fee-only basis, without commission-based compensation. His approach emphasizes clarity, education, and long-term planning tailored to each client’s circumstances and priorities. Alex earned his Bachelor of Business Administration in Finance, with a specialization in Personal Financial Planning, from the C.T. Bauer College of Business at the University of Houston. He resides in The Heights with his wife, Andrea, their daughter, Zoe, and their dogs. Alex values time with family and community and believes those relationships help shape the care, responsibility, and perspective he brings to his work with clients.
